Keys Group is seeking compassionate Waking Night Support Workers for their new Summerhill Avenue care home opening in Newport in 2025. In this vital role, you'll support residents with daily activities, healthcare needs, and personal care, promoting their independence and personal growth.
The position offers a fair salary, career development opportunities, and comprehensive benefits, including a paid DBS check and access to various qualifications. Join a team committed to creating a nurturing environment for individuals with acquired brain injuries.

How to prepare for a job interview at Keys Group
✨Understand the Role
Before your interview, make sure you thoroughly understand what a Waking Night Support Worker does. Familiarise yourself with the daily activities and healthcare needs of residents, especially those with acquired brain injuries. This will help you demonstrate your knowledge and passion for the role.
✨Show Your Compassion
In this line of work, compassion is key. Prepare examples from your past experiences where you've shown empathy and support to others. Whether it's in a professional or personal setting, being able to convey your caring nature will resonate well with the interviewers.
✨Highlight Independence Promotion
Since the role focuses on promoting independence, think about how you can encourage residents to engage in their own care. Be ready to discuss strategies you've used or would use to empower individuals, showcasing your commitment to their personal growth.
✨Ask Thoughtful Questions
At the end of the interview, don’t forget to ask questions! Inquire about the team dynamics, training opportunities, or how success is measured in the role. This shows your genuine interest in the position and helps you assess if it’s the right fit for you.
